(647) 932-2147 law@shapirohalpern.com

Criminal Law

Criminal Law

Shapiro Halpern Law Criminal Law | Traffic Tickets Toronto handles all criminal law cases.

Being charged with a criminal offence can have life altering consequences that can have an impact on your freedom, your reputation and your ability to earn a living. If you’ve been charged with a criminal offence, you need experienced legal representation fighting to protect your rights. An effective criminal defence can mean the difference between a prison sentence and a reduced or dismissed charge.

Contact Us

Fight Traffic Tickets Services

WHY CHOOSE Shaprio Halpern Criminal Law Toronto services?

Our team of criminal defence lawyers, licensed paralegals, and former police officers know the law inside and out. With lots of satisfied clients, we are the most experienced team of legal professionals in Canada. We can help you avoid getting a criminal record. We have an expert understanding of court procedures and the methods of law enforcement.

With our assistance, our clients have successfully:

police handcuffs

Stayed out of jail

icons8 law 100

Maintained the ability to drive and kept their driver’s licence


Protected their job/career

icons8 law 100

Maintained the ability to travel


Criminal Defence

Criminal legal fees can be overwhelming. As Paralegals, SHAPIRO HALPERN LAW fee structure is significantly less than those of a criminal lawyer.

SHAPIRO HALPERN LAW can represent you in summary conviction criminal offences, which are criminal offences where the maximum punishment is less than six months of imprisonment.

Some common criminal charges of this sort are:

  • Domestic assault
  • Dangerous driving
  • Common assault
  • Fraud
  • Mischief
  • Theft/Shoplifting
  • Possession of under 5mg of illicit substances
  • DUI and other more serious criminal charges under direct supervision of a criminal lawyer.

Charges under

  • Unfair convictions
  • Demerit points
  • Substantial fines
  • Additional license suspensions
  • Possible incarceration

Get In Touch

We often attend court for you! You are usually not required to attend court until the final appearance or trial date. We attend the preliminary appearances for you.

Call Us Now


We understand that dealing with the law can be tough. Thats why we strive to defend of all clients to our highest standard

Call For Free Consult